Qualifications
MD or DO degree from an accredited medical school. Board Certification or Board Eligibility in Anesthesiology. Current Pennsylvania medical licensure or ability to obtain prior to start date.UPMC's Commitment to Diversity and Inclusion: - UPMC is an Equal Opportunity Employer/Disability/Veteran.
